Bladder stones are crystallized minerals that form when concentrated urine hardens in the bladder after urination. Over 90 percent of your urine is water. The rest contains minerals ... Ultrasound. This test bounces sound waves off organs and other structures in your body to create images that help detect bladder stones. X-ray. An X-ray of your kidneys, ureters and bladder helps your doctor determine whether you have bladder stones.
